Stop the e-voting pilots in your area: It works!

There are two points in government on which pressure can be applied, the Department of Constitutional Affairs who are running the pilot programme, and local authorities who will apply for and administer individual pilots. The Department is a single target, but quite well fortified, shall we say. But for local authorities the pilots are voluntary so getting them to rule themselves out is quite possible.

The first success is Brighton & Hove City Council. Thanks to the Green Party councillors, the council's Chief Executive Alan McCarthy has ruled the city out of running pilots in 2007.
